Texas Goldentop

Euthamia gymnospermoides Greene

Steve Davis   cc-by-nc-4.0

Euthamia gymnospermoides (Texas Goldentop) is a species of perennial herb in the family Asteraceae. They have a self-supporting growth form. They are native to Canada, The Contiguous United States, and North America. They have achenes. Flowers are visited by small white and Sandhill Skipper.
